On 26th April, Steve Sellers & Neil Ruff RAN the London Marathon to raise money for this year's Official Charity, The Children's Trust
The Children's Trust provides care, education and therapy to children with multiple disabilities and complex health needs.
Every parent hopes that his or her child will be born healthy, and will progress through childhood without serious injury or illness. Unfortunately sometimes these expectations are shattered; children are born with disabilities or become disabled suddenly as a result of an accident or illness. The Children's Trust is there to help these children and their families.
The combination of services that the Trust offers children with multiple disabilities is unique. There are around 75 children at The Children's Trust at any one time, and The Children's Trust helps hundreds of families each year in many ways:
Residential Care - Short Breaks - Rehabilitation for children with acquired brain injuries - Transitional care between hospital & home - Outreach (caring for children in their own home) - The Children's Trust School, St. Margaret's
Some of the costs The Children's Trust faces:
£15 for a fibre-optic light to capture a child's attention
£48 for a special switch that will help a child to use a computer
£57 for a huge physio ball to help a child with little or no mobility balance & play
£125 for a squidgy floor mat for a child to lay on for physiotherapy
£300 for a special sling to move children with multiple disabilities in comfort
